Lived In Streamwood IL, Schaumburg IL, Elgin IL, Terre Haute IN
Related To Ilan Wang, Xin Wang, Bin Wang, Diana Sun, Chen WangAlso known as Elaine I Wang, Ilan L Wang, Ellen WangIncludes Address(13) Phone(2) Email(3)
Lived In Schaumburg IL, Streamwood IL, Wauconda IL, Oswego IL
Related To Ilan Wang, Bin Wang, Xin Wang, Chen Wang, Wang IfangAlso known as Ifang I Wang, IlanWang, Ellen Wang, Wang IfangIncludes Address(34) Phone(7) Email(6)